DFRobot BLE4.1 Module is a Bluetooth 4.1 module with a DA14681 processor with a 3.3 V power supply. It is characterized by low energy consumption. The module integrates an advanced energy management system, supplied with the Li-on battery charging circuit with a maximum current of 400mA. It can be powered directly from the USB port. The module offers numerous I / O ports and communication interfaces: SPI, I2C, UART as well as PWM signal generation. The processor can communicate directly via the USB port (USB1.1 standard). In addition, the module offers the possibility of handling up to 4 connections at the same time, thanks to which it can be combined with other modules in a star or tree network. It is easy to use thanks to the Arduino library support. The module will be a comprehensive solution for IoT devices, devices requiring low power consumption or a network of distributed sensors. It can be used, for example, in the cooperation of several mobile robots.
